MICROORGANISMS IN THE ENVIRONMENT
II. Materials
O 7 sterile petri dishes
Sterile nutrient agar
O Water bath
III. Procedures:
1. Melt nutrient agar in a water bath and cool to approximately 45-degree Celcius.
2. Into each sterile petri dish, pour about 15-20 ml nutrient agar following aseptic technique.
3. Upon solidification of the medium, label dishes A, B, C, D, E, F, & G.
A. Remove cover and swab a tv remote control then rub it over the surface of the agar,then cover the
plate.
B. Remove cover and cough directly into the agar surface 2 to 3 times then cover the plate.
C. Remove cover and rub tips of your fingers over the surface of the agar then cover the plate.
D. Remove cover and swab the sole of the shoe and rub tips over the surface of the agar, then cover the
plate.
E. Pick up a small amount of dust on a piece of cotton and rub over the agar surface, cover the plate.
F. Open the petri dish and pass it over the hair, then cover.
G. Leave this plate untouched.
4. Incubate the plates in an inverted position at 37-degree Celcius. Make your observation after three
days.
